Output ebcb92f7a8d05b706033c59ada5617892ecc9d7f4cf1a490038c75c6497b2a2d:0

value
10608311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a135f074d9158ed8a08b171ad0806a23bc42b66a OP_EQUAL
address
3GPRLCJ2i8eW1NSSh3jCKLMaqeB8Qs5LGA
transaction
ebcb92f7a8d05b706033c59ada5617892ecc9d7f4cf1a490038c75c6497b2a2d
confirmations
339526
spent
true